My trip to Strictly on Saturday
<<
<
1 of 2
>>
>
chrisdebag
01-12-2009
i was lucky to get tickets for saturdays show and i wish i could go every week

i arrived all excited at tv centre at 11.40 and joined the queue

it was full of excited women and i was 15th in line

at 12.30 a car pulled up to the centre and the window rolled down and it was chris waving. At this one woman run all way to his car and hugged him lol

at ten to three chris took the time and trouble to walk all the way down the line and had his pic taken and gave autographs he waswearing his red team cola top

he was the only one to do this and he is so lovely in real life

we finally got in at 3.45 and we went into the bar where i had a budweiser

then a woman announced that they needed people who had been from 1 to 40 in the line to go into the studio and sit behind the judges as they were to do some link to be shown in the week

ricky and erin were there and they did a little dance and bruce came out and he was very good with the audience

we then go moved to the balcony for the main show i was above the judges and near to where the stairs are they come down

well chris and ola stole the show what a dance the crowd went mad and they were the only ones to get a standing ovation after they finished their dance

i loved the charleston ali was great and leilas routine so fun

ricky left me cold and natalie sadly looked the worst

i was so nervous hoping chris would go through and i think i sort of squeaked when they did

vincent was so upset at end but he thanked the crowd for the support

chris asked us in the balcony whether we were warm now as the line outside was pretty cold

if anyone has tickets you will have a great time i loved every second of it

bruce sang a song for us before the main show started he comes on ten minutes before and talks to us

the reason the crowd is sometimes laughing as they go back to bruce when tess finishes in her room is that he does things like moves his legs in a funny fashion. bruce seemed a lot better live and he and tess did great

i want to go again
